Output 85a12d76ee73f2c622d7da663f51dfe4d95e856ba4647779435ac398fdbcb963:2

value
177158379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a7a25c916bbdccf21ffdc0ad7968f34dfaae59b OP_EQUAL
address
MLXMosE9b9ghq3XxPvrkNHvHU2rvLgkwJx
transaction
85a12d76ee73f2c622d7da663f51dfe4d95e856ba4647779435ac398fdbcb963
spent
true